Overlake Service League was founded in 1911 and since that time has provided Emergency and Family Assistance as well as holiday programs to promote stability and independence for those most vulnerable in Bellevue .
Who is eligible?
Anyone living within the geographical boundaries of the Bellevue School District. Clients must agree to a home visit to access services. For those who are homeless, special arrangements can be made.
What can you expect from a home visit?
The Social Service Administrator will visit you at your home to assess your immediate and overall needs. You will be asked to provide supportive documents for your specific requests as well as the following:
- Social Security Card, Green Card, Visitor Visa, etc.
- Rental or Mortgage Agreement
- Verification of Income
The Social Service Administrator will:
- Match needs with Overlake Service League programs and services
- Provide referrals to other resources for assistance
- Advocate on your behalf
- Assist you in planning a course of action
